“The competitors is absurd” – Dessers optimistic about making Nigeria’s AFCON squad

Peseiro has plenty of attacking choices, however Dessers is optimistic that he might make the AFCON squad

Tremendous Eagles striker Cyriel Dessers is optimistic that he’ll make Nigeria’s squad for the upcoming 2023 Africa Cup of Nations in Ivory Coast, Soccernet experiences.

Coach Jose Peseiro needs to information Nigeria to a fourth AFCON crown in Ivory Coast in January subsequent 12 months, and he has the devices to do it. Nigeria boast of among the greatest legs on the continent, particularly within the attacking division.

The Tremendous Eagles have World beaters like Victor Osimhen and Victor Boniface, who’ve the Serie A and the Bundesliga on chokehold.

There are additionally different stars like Taiwo Awoniyi and Sadiq Umar, who might ship the products on their good day.

Nevertheless, regardless of the standard attackers at Peseiro’s disposal, Dessers is trying to break into the fold. The Nigerian striker has not been a part of the Tremendous Eagles fold in the previous few worldwide breaks, however he’s optimistic that he might get a spot when the ultimate squad record is launched in January.

“The previous few occasions I used to be within the Nigeria pre-selection squad, however not within the remaining choice. When you have a look at the opposite strikers and the shape that they’re in, I can perceive that, Dessers stated per Daily Record.

“We’ve got just a few gamers competing to be the third or fourth striker after which it depends upon type. The competitors in Nigeria is absurd. I might have chosen to play for Belgium, however I’m very pleased with my selection.

Dessers has not impressed a lot since his switch from Cremonese to Rangers in the summertime. The 28-year-old striker has 5 objectives in 20 appearances for the Gers.

If he needs to make it to the AFCON, he has to begin banging within the objectives aplenty for the previous Scottish champions.
